Where can I obtain additional information about the Law Schools program of clinical legal education?

0

Because the law school s program of practice based instruction is large and complex, offering students many choices and opportunities, we suggest you stop by the Office of Clinical and Pro Bono Programs located on the first floor of Austin Hall (102 and 108). Staff of the Office of Clinical and Pro Bono Programs counsel and advise students on course and placement selection; register, admit and waitlist students for clinical courses; develop, monitor and evaluate clinical placements; and oversee and coordinate the curriculum-based clinics, student practice organizations and externship placements. Please feel free to stop by our office at Austin 102, call us at 617 495-5202, or email us via e-mail clinical@law.harvard.edu. We look forward to meeting and working with you!
